<p dir="auto">Brown worked as a circus acrobat as a child and later played semi-pro baseball. I'd put his athletic ability on a par with Buster Keaton. Look for his Warner Bros. flicks of the early 30s to see him at his best. Films like FIREMAN, SAVE MY CHILD and ELMER THE GREAT. Unfortunately, after leaving Warners, he made a lotta career missteps.<br />
